Output db6cee163a650a12986539dab75f9864758818e82f9cc65b388ffca2bd17996e:0

value
132588049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f75c40ad75e0de593c6f5e4d303b809abe9b45e OP_EQUAL
address
3DJxpR8KPLUCCFCK65veHof3q2idoshFcA
transaction
db6cee163a650a12986539dab75f9864758818e82f9cc65b388ffca2bd17996e
spent
true